1. Do not arch your back and buttocks or hold your breath, as this will cause your muscles to lose control and is dangerous.

2. While training the pectoralis major, you should also strengthen the triceps in your upper arms. Without well-developed triceps, it is impossible to bench press a heavy barbell, and it is impossible to develop well-developed pectoralis major muscles.

3. At the beginning, the axis of the dumbbell should be placed 1 cm above the nipple (middle of the pectoral muscle) to allow the pectoralis major to exert force. If you hold the dumbbells on your shoulders, you are only exercising your shoulder muscles.

4. Be sure to spread your elbows. When doing the bench press, keep your arms open at the sides of your body, so you can basically complete the movement by relying solely on your chest muscles. When the spacing is wide, the pectoralis major muscles are mainly exercised, while when the spacing is narrow, the deltoid muscles are mainly exercised.

5. The effect of chest muscle exercises is not ideal. You can try the incline press, lying on an incline board with a certain angle (about 20-25 degrees), and then practice with a barbell or dumbbell of the same weight. By giving the muscles a new stimulus from a different angle, you will soon see new effects.
